About Lihir

Our Lihir Operation, located on the beautiful island of Niolam, approximately 800km north of Papua New Guinea's capital, Port Moresby, is one of the world’s largest gold mines. Set within a geothermically active, extinct volcanic crater, Lihir operates an open-pit mine producing refractory ore, which undergoes pressure oxidation and conventional leaching to recover gold. Our workforce includes both residential and commute rosters, creating a diverse and dynamic team. Lihir offers a range of recreational facilities, including a gym, sports club, restaurant, bar, swimming pool, tennis and squash courts, and a 9-hole golf course. For those who enjoy the outdoors, the Lihir fishing and boating clubs provide access to pristine waters and beaches, while our onsite deli and café serve fresh local and imported produce, barista-made coffee, and freshly baked goods.

We are proud to work closely with the local Lihirian community and value its vibrant culture. Through initiatives like our School to Mine program, we offer meaningful employment, training, and development opportunities for Lihirian men and women, as well as scholarships and vocational apprenticeships. We also partner with the New Ireland Province to ensure economic benefits flow directly to the community, strengthening our commitment to sustainable development and positive local impact.

Purpose

Our Lihir operation in Papua New Guinea is currently recruiting for the position of Superintendent – Water. This is a residential role based at the Lihir Gold Limited operation, offering an opportunity to live and work on-site.

The Superintendent – Water, reporting to the Manager – Mine Technical Services, is responsible for overseeing all water management activities across the site, including supply, dewatering, drainage, treatment, and conservation. This role ensures reliable water availability for processing, site operations, and camps, while managing runoff and maintaining full environmental compliance. A key focus is pit dewatering and drainage to support safe mining operations, balancing operational needs with environmental and regulatory responsibilities.

Essential Duties

Among other accountabilities, the Superintendent - Water will be responsible for:

  • Lead and oversee all aspects of site-wide water management, including supply, dewatering, drainage, treatment, conservation, and discharge, ensuring efficient and sustainable use of water resources.
  • Develop and implement water management plans that support environmental compliance, including strategies for recycling, conservation, and minimising impact, while conducting regular audits and assessments.
  • Monitor water quality and usage, collect and analyse data, and report on performance metrics to identify trends and areas for improvement.
  • Work closely with other teams on site, as well as local communities and regulators, to make sure our water plans are clear, coordinated, and on the same page with everyone involved.
  • Lead and develop the water management team, conducting training, performance evaluations, and risk management activities, while overseeing consultants and contractors to ensure project and compliance standards are met.
